Wenye Wang (王文野), Professor, IEEE Fellow
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ering,
NC State University
Wenye Wang received her Ph.D. degree in Electrical and Computer Engineering, from Georgia Institute of Technology (GaTech), with Dr. Ian F. Akyildiz (2002). She joined the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ering, NC State University, as an assistant professor and has been an associate professor since Fall 2008, and a full professor since Fall 2014. Her research interests include modeling and performance of wireless networking, spectrum sensing, prediction, and management, and their applications to Smart Grid and Internet of Things (IoT) systems. Dr. Wang received NSF CAREER Award in 2006. She is an ACM member and an IEEE Fellow of 2017 class.

Research: The Networking of Wireless Information Systems (NetWiS) laboratory led by Dr. Wenye Wang is focused on in-depth understanding, modeling, and performance evaluation of fundamental problems in mobile and wireless systems, such as mobility and spectrum management, with broad applications to the Internet of Things (IoT) systems. Our lab members include undergraduate students who gain experience in research and prepare for their graduate study, and graduate students who aim to make novel contributions to the wireless networking area. Currently, we are interested in spectrum monitoring and management in multi-RAT (radio access technology), as well as commodity (5G/WiFi bands) RF sensing for a variety of IoT applications.
